We provide a detailed three step design service; discovery, collation, and execution. Our entire design process is meticulous, with every stage receiving our utmost support and attention, and is tailored for each project.
discovery.
The first stage of our lighting design process is discovery, where we focus on understanding your needs and expectations.
We begin by discussing what initially led you to seek a lighting designer and exploring your current knowledge of lighting design. This helps us tailor our approach to your unique situation.
During this conversation, we clarify your expectations and explain our comprehensive process, which includes design, integration, and handover. At this stage, the only requirement from you for a design cost estimate is providing floor plans.


collation.
The second stage of our lighting design process, collation, focuses on gathering all the necessary information to ensure a tailored and comprehensive design.
At this stage, we send an information request to the customer and all relevant parties involved in the project. This request covers key details required to create a lighting plan that enhances the architecture, complements the interior design, highlights joinery, and provides tailored solutions for kitchens, bathrooms, special areas of interest, and garden spaces.
By consolidating this information, we set the foundation for a thoughtful and cohesive lighting design.
execution.
Once all necessary information is gathered, we develop detailed design works, including 3D callouts, 2D layouts, technical reports, driver and cabling specifications, control system schematics, and load schedules.
A full product specification is prepared, with a first draft issued for review. We refine the design through as many revisions as needed to ensure perfection before delivering the final draft.
This stage also includes comprehensive project management, providing on-site and off-site support, direct communication with trades, and efficient product supply management to ensure timely delivery and installation for each area.
